what is the vertical asymptotes?
Respuesta :
dianaaivanov
dianaaivanov
03-01-2019
“The vertical asymptote is a vertical line that the graph of a function approaches but never touches. To find the vertical asymptote(s) of a rational function, we set the denominator equal to 0 and solve for x.”
